## Break-Glass: PedalShift Rebalancer

PedalShift moves bikes between Harrowgate docks overnight. If the scheduler assigns impossible routes and trucks idle, new team members may invoke break-glass to pause dispatch and revert to yesterday's plan. All uses are logged and reviewed.

The pause command in the PedalShift console requires the recovery passphrase shown below.

vault phrase of fahog-yajof = istael-zorwyn

## Break-Glass Access: Catalog Cache Invalidation

For security review: emergency invalidation of the Wrenmarket product catalog cache bypasses the normal approval queue. Break-glass use is logged immutably and pages the on-call lead automatically. The flush tool requires dual acknowledgment and expires its session after ten minutes. To activate the break-glass console, the operator must enter the passphrase recorded below.

unlock words, kawig-bawef: belax-sorir-druax-ulaiel-wenael-belael

## Releases

Pairwise (the Holloway matching service) ships tagged builds only. Each release includes GC-pause benchmarks; any build with p99 pause above 150ms is rejected at the gate, since pause spikes previously masked a request-smuggling window. Reviewers should confirm benchmark artifacts are signed alongside the binary — unsigned benchmark output is treated as a failed gate. Releases are verified against the key below.

signing key of bagap-yawep = bky13_TbfT6ZMUoGJo2